What Is a Qualified Domestic Relations Order?
A qualified domestic relations order (QDRO) shares a former spouse’s retirement benefits with the other spouse in a divorce. If property division involves retirement benefits, the divorce agreement will use a QDRO to divide the assets. QDROs can involve:
- IRAs
- 401(k)s
- Pension plans
- Employee stock ownership plans (ESOPs)
- Defined benefit plans

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Lawyer for a Qualified Domestic Relations Order?
Without a divorce lawyer, you may not know all your ex’s assets if they hide them from the court. Your spouse may wrongly claim their retirement assets are separate property when state law treats them as community property. Without your share of retirement benefits, you may struggle financially after retirement.
How Much Does a Divorce Cost?
The final cost of your divorce ultimately depends a great deal on both you and your spouse’s approach to the proceedings. If you can negotiate all of the terms of your divorce without any extended courtroom batters, you will spend much less money than if either of you insists on taking the divorce to trial. The use of outside experts, such as child psychologists and financial experts, will also affect the final cost.
How Long Does a Divorce Take?
Again, this depends on how you and your spouse approach the divorce proceedings. If you can easily work out everything, due to no-fault divorce laws, you may be able to complete the process in a few months. Every dispute that needs a judge’s or mediator’s supervision, however, will take time. Court appointments are typically not available on short notice.
